The Lead Technical Manager will be responsible for managing a group of Technical Officer for security equipment installation, testing, commissioning and system programming in accordance to required standards.
Job Responsibilities:
Oversee the whole process of service cum maintenance workflow.
Front line contact with client representatives on all service/maintenance related issues.
Lead a team of service team members.
Prepare service scope and develop service plans, define resource loading, skill requirements, tracking milestones and metrics.
Determine new, creative ways to employ teams on service deliveries and distribute responsibilities.
Manage day-to-day client interactions and expectations for optimal results
Continually seek and capitalize upon opportunities to increase customer satisfaction and deepen client relationships.
Possess a knowledge base of each client's business, organization and objectives.
Be responsible for operationally managing multiple aspects of the team.
Must be a team player.
Ensure smooth progress and timely delivery and completion of maintenance commitments to clients
Perform a wide variety of technical and non-technical tasks.
Enhance current documentation of all infrastructure components and operation processes.
Track and identify the new opportunities to improve our methodology and training offerings.
Build technical relationship with prospects or existing/new customers.
Sets targets, implement guidelines, and assists with any issues the team member may have.
Communicates effectively with clients to identify needs and evaluate alternative technical solutions and strategies.
Handle customer complains.
Participate in all programs and enforces all policies relating to performance evaluations and career development planning.
All other duties as assigned by management.
Job Requirements:
Minimum 6 years related experience with demonstrable record of success
Good communicator with excellent coordination skills
Ability to work with multiple discipline projects
Committed individual with great initiative and strong problem-solving skills
Diploma or Degree in Electrical / Mechanical Engineering/Computer Science or its equivalents
Possess good leadership and organizing abilities
Experience in the Security and CCTV industry and exposure to products and operations will be an added advantage
